COMMERCE BUSINESS DAILY ISSUE OF NOVEMBER 25,1998 PSA#2229

SP -- SITE ACQUISITION NEW SPRINGFIELD COURTHOUSE SITE SELECTION FOR NEW FEDERAL COURTHOUSE SPRINGFIELD, MASSACHUSETTS Public notice is hereby given that the General Services Administration (GSA) will conduct an investigation of possible sites for a new federal courthouse in Springfield, MA. Representatives of GSA will begin the site investigation in Springfield, MA on or about December 21, 1998. This site acquisition is being conducted pursuant to statutory authority contained in the Public Buildings Act of 1959, as amended. 40 U.S.C. Sec. 601, et seq. Pursuant to this authority, GSA is authorized to conduct this site selection without regard to the competitive procurement procedures contained in Title III of the Federal Property and Administrative Services Act of 1949, as amended, commonly referred to as the Competition in Contracting Act. All offered sites must satisfy the following minimum criteria to be considered: A site of not less than 100,000 square feet will be required. An offer may consist of more than one parcel, but the offered site should have a minimum frontage of not less than 250 feet on the principal street. THE SITE MUST BE LOCATED WITHIN, OR IMMEDIATELY ADJACENT TO, THE FOLLOWING DELINEATED AREA WITHIN SPRINGFIELD_S CENTRAL BUSINESS DISTRICT (CBD): Within or immediately adjacent to the area bounded by the following: The Connecticut River to Liberty Street to Chestnut Street to Lyman Street to Spring Street to Union Street back to the Connecticut River. Owners of parcels aggregating less than the size specified, but to which adjoining parcels may be added to produce a site of required size, are encouraged to offer such parcels for inspection. Sites which may be donated to the Federal Government are solicited as well as sites which are available for sale. Owners or agents desiring to submit sites for consideration should submit site data by 2:00 p.m., Friday, December 18, 1998 along with an original Form of Offer to Frank Saviano, Project Manager at the address listed below: General Services Administration (1PC) Public Buildings ServiceNew Springfield Courthouse Project T.P. O_Neill Federal Building, Room 975 10 Causeway Street Boston, MA 02222 To obtain a Form of Offer, please contact Mr. Saviano at (617) 565-5494. Any offer made by someone who is not the owner of an offered site must include a letter of authorization from the owner or principal granting the offeror permission to submit the site. The Government will select the site considered to be the most advantageous to the United States, all factors considered. In order to ensure that the selected site is most advantageous to the United States, the Government will also consider any unique attributes or other nuances of a site deemed worthy of consideration. This advertisement is not a basis for negotiation and notice is hereby given that sites other than those offered in response to this advertisement may be considered.
